Understanding Network Storage
Before diving into the methods of connecting your hard drive to the network, it’s essential to understand what network storage means. Network storage allows multiple users and devices to access data from a central location. This could be particularly useful for small businesses or households with several devices requiring data access.
There are primarily two types of network storage options:
- Network Attached Storage (NAS): These are dedicated devices that come with one or more hard drives and connect directly to your network, providing easy access from various devices.
- Direct Attached Storage (DAS): This is a storage device, like an external hard drive, that connects to a single computer via USB, Thunderbolt, or eSATA. While not a typical network solution, it can be made accessible over a network using specific methods.
Understanding these options will help you choose the right method for your needs.
Connecting a Hard Drive to Your Network
There are several methods to connect a hard drive to your network. Each method has its pros and cons, depending on your specific use case. Let’s explore the most popular ones.
Method 1: Using a Network Attached Storage (NAS) Device
The most straightforward way to connect a hard drive to the network is by using a NAS device. Here’s how you can set it up:
Step 1: Choose a NAS Device
Select a NAS device that fits your storage needs. Consider factors such as:
– Number of bays for hard drives
– Data redundancy features (RAID)
– Compatibility with your operating systems
– Network interface options (Gigabit Ethernet, Wi-Fi)
Step 2: Install the Hard Drives
Follow the manufacturer’s instructions to install your hard drives into the NAS. This may involve sliding the drives into bays and securing them with screws or locks.
Step 3: Connect to Your Network
Using an Ethernet cable, connect the NAS device to your router. Ensure that your network has enough bandwidth to support multiple users accessing the NAS simultaneously, especially if you plan to stream media files.
Step 4: Power On and Configure
Power on the NAS device and follow the on-screen instructions to configure it. This usually involves setting up an admin account, choosing your storage configuration, and creating shared folders.
Step 5: Accessing the NAS
Once the setup is complete, access the NAS from your computer by entering its IP address or hostname in your file explorer. You can map it as a network drive for easier access.
Method 2: Setting Up a Shared Folder on Your Computer
If you don’t wish to invest in a NAS device, you can turn your computer into a file server. This method involves sharing an external hard drive connected to your computer with other network-connected devices.
Step 1: Connect the External Hard Drive
Plug the external hard drive into your computer using a USB port and ensure it’s recognized by the operating system.
Step 2: Set Up Sharing on Windows
- Right-click on the external hard drive in “This PC.”
- Select “Properties” and go to the “Sharing” tab.
- Click “Share” and select the users you want to share with. You can allow them to either read-only or have full control.
- Click “Share” to confirm the settings and take note of the network path displayed.
Step 3: Access the Shared Drive on Other Devices
On other devices within the same network, you can access the shared folder by entering the network path in the file explorer. For example: \\YourComputerName\SharedFolderName

Method 3: Using a Router with USB Port
Many modern routers come equipped with USB ports that allow you to connect an external hard drive directly. Here’s how you can utilize this feature:
Step 1: Check Router Compatibility
Ensure that your router supports USB storage and has the necessary software (like FTP and SMB file-sharing protocols).
Step 2: Connect Your Hard Drive
Plug your external hard drive into the USB port on the router.
Step 3: Access the Router Settings
Log in to your router’s admin panel. You can usually do this by typing your router’s IP address into your web browser.
Step 4: Configure USB Settings
Locate the USB settings in your router’s admin panel. Enable file sharing, and set appropriate permissions for users who will access the hard drive.
Step 5: Accessing Files Over the Network
Similar to the NAS and the shared folder method, you can access the connected hard drive from any device on the network using the router’s IP address or designated hostname.
Security Considerations
While connecting a hard drive to your network opens new doors for convenience and accessibility, it also raises potential security risks. Here are several key considerations:
Data Encryption
Ensure that sensitive data is encrypted, whether on the NAS, shared folders, or directly connected drives. This adds a layer of protection against unauthorized access.
User Permissions
When setting up shared folders or NAS devices, carefully manage user permissions to ensure that only authorized individuals have access to certain files or directories.
Regular Backups
Implement a regular backup strategy to avoid data loss. Whether that means local backups or using cloud services, having a backup ensures your data remains safe against corruption or hardware failure.
Keep Software Updated
Whether it’s your router firmware, NAS operating system, or computer, keeping software updated is crucial for security. Many updates include patches that guard against vulnerabilities.

Can I access my network hard drive remotely?
Yes, many NAS devices offer remote access features that allow you to access your files from anywhere with an internet connection. To set this up, you will typically need to enable remote access in the device settings, configure a dynamic DNS (DDNS) service if needed, and make sure that the necessary ports are forwarded on your router. Instructions are often provided in the NAS’s user manual.
For external hard drives connected to a router, accessing files remotely is usually more complex and may require third-party software solutions or additional configurations. In either case, always ensure that secure measures, such as VPN access or strong passwords, are implemented to protect your data during remote access.
